Has anyone got a recommendation for a good drying towel? I've bought the bright turquoise autofinesse one but when I went to dry my car with it it just dragged and wasn't smooth on the paint at all. I've heard good things about klinkorea ones but the size I'd want is never in stock anywhere.

Having just spent £800 on a heavy paint correction and ceramic coating I'd rather avoid sandpapering my paint with a sketchy draggy towel!

They are expensive, but save so much time! Also, you don't have to wring it out. It actually works better when it's absorbed a lot of water (heavier) you don't press on it, literally just drag it across the car.

You won't be disappointed (except by the weather). You don't need to put pressure on it. I just drag it lightly across all the flat surfaces. Then fold it into quarters and run it once in the same direction across all the side surfaces.
